Smoking bans had been tied to a lower in fitness problems
and deaths - particularly the ones related to heart ailment, researchers report
in the journal Cochrane Library, on-line February 4.
"I assume the bans benefit everyone through a discount
of secondhand smoke exposure," said senior creator Cecily
Kelleher, of university college Dublin
in eire.
imposing those bans across the globe, especially in
developing countries with rising continual fitness problems, may want to have a
massive effect at the population's health, she informed Reuters health.
Tobacco is currently chargeable for the death of
approximately one in every 10 adults around the sector, the researchers write.
They did their analysis for the Cochrane Collaboration, which is understood for
reviewing scientific proof and determining its pleasant.
A previous Cochrane overview determined that smoking bans
reduced people's exposure to secondhand smoke, but back then the reviewers were
not in a position to expose that reduced smoke publicity caused better health.
"We undertook the authentic assessment in 2010, and the
proof base was nothing just like the evidence now," said Kelleher.
This time, the researchers in particular included research
that seemed past secondhand smoke publicity. as an instance, they seemed in
medical databases for studies inspecting hyperlinks among smoking bans and
costs of coronary heart assaults, strokes, respiratory issues, toddler health
and deaths.
in the long run, they protected 77 studies from 21 nations.
most of the research used facts from hospitals, country wide fitness registries
and workplaces.
forty-3 studies especially tested coronary heart attacks and
acute coronary syndrome. Thirty-three of the papers discovered a link among
introducing smoking bans and a lower in the ones occasions.
Of the six studies that examined the hyperlink among strokes
and smoking bans, five observed benefits.
as an example, a study from eire mentioned a 26% fall in
deaths from coronary heart disorder and a 32% decrease in stroke deaths.
The reviewers additionally determined evidence that the
smoking bans were useful to respiration and newborn health.
The first-rate of evidence at the back of those findings
have been very low, however.
"these are persuasive that these bans are useful,"
Kelleher said of the outcomes.
She delivered, however, that higher and extra uniform
studies is wanted to reinforce the evidence in the back of those benefits.
"in case you study a number of the authors'
conclusions, that is very compelling evidence of the consequences of any policy
that impacts secondhand smoke exposure," said Liz Klein, of the center of
Excellence in Regulatory Tobacco technological know-how on the Ohio
nation college in Columbus.
preceding pointers that smoking bans help save you heart
attacks have been met with skepticism, stated Klein, who changed into no longer
concerned in the new overview.
"in this evaluate, that proof is so always robust that
it indicates while you ban smoking in those public areas, you spot much less
heart assaults on the community degree," she told Reuters health.
Klein said no longer each city or country has these policies
in vicinity, however in which they do exist, they protect the general public's
fitness.
Kelleher said, "The message for policy makers is that
bans are an effective method."
